Women's Volleyball Earns 3-1 Win at Becker

LEICESTER, Mass. – Curry College defeated Becker College 3-1 (25-20, 23-25, 25-22, 25-18) in non-conference women's volleyball action Thursday evening in the Leicester Gymnasium. The win propels the Colonels to 3-5, while the Hawks remain winless at 0-5.

Junior middle hitter Emily Boudreau (Marshfield, Mass.) led the way for Curry with 16 kills. Hannah Robison (Cumberland, R.I.) contributed a match high 20 assists, in addition to four kills. Freshman outside hitter Nicole Grambley (North Attleboro, Mass.) added five serve aces, nine kills and a team high 11 digs to help the Colonels to their third win of the season.

Senior Jacqueline Chila (Monroe, Conn,) led the way for the Hawks with a team high 12 kills. Katelyn Burns (Fall River, Mass.) had eight kills and a game high 12 digs in a losing effort. Freshman Marissa Turner (Coventry, R.I.) finished with nine kills.

Both teams return to the court on Saturday, September 14 when Becker travels to Green Mountain College at 12:00 p.m. Curry is slated to host Salem State and Suffolk University beginning at 11:00 a.m. (Release courtesy of Becker Sports Information)
